Casual Exam Invigilator
1 week ago
**Contract**: 0 hours
**Working pattern**: Non specific; hours offered in accordance with exam schedule
**Hourly pay rate**: £12.26 per hour
We are seeking to recruit exam invigilators to work with our existing team, to facilitate the smooth running of the secondary public and internal examinations here at The Burgess Hill Academy.
The post would be ideally suited to applicants who feel a sense of responsibility for today's young people and who are able to work flexible daytime hours. This is a casual contract, so hours and days will vary dependent on need. However, availability between the hours of 8.00am and 4.00pm is required. Examinations take place throughout the academic year, starting in October and ending with the GCSE examinations in May and June.
The role involves:
- Assisting with the set up of exam rooms
- Patrolling exam rooms during exams and monitoring students behaviour
- Collecting exam papers at the end of exams
- Ensuring compliance with statutory policies related to the role
**Experience of working in a school or with young people would be an advantage, however, full training for the role will be provided. What we are looking for are applicants who can**:
- Concentrate and work quickly under pressure
- Maintain confidentially
- Use initiative in response to unexpected situations
- Be aware and committed to equal opportunities and diversity
